One Direction’s Liam Payne Is Officially Going Solo

He just inked a deal with Capitol Records

UPDATE (10/17/16): Liam Payne has inked a North American solo deal with Republic Records, home of Ariana Grande, The Weeknd, Nicki Minaj, and more. Republic's CEO and co-founder Monte Lipman said, "We're honored by Liam's decision to join Republic Records, and have extremely high expectations for his solo career."

--

Ever since One Direction went on hiatus earlier this year, rumors have abounded as to which of the remaining four members would put out a solo album first. Now, it looks like we might be closer to an answer.

Liam Payne announced on Twitter Thursday (July 21) that he’s signed to Capitol Records as a solo artist. "One Direction will always be my home and family but I'm very excited to see what this chapter brings,” he wrote.

Last September, Payne commented on how he saw 1D’s hiatus as an opportunity. "I realize now is the time to start branching out and exploring,” he said in an interview with Attitude, though back then said he he wasn’t thinking about working on a solo album.

Payne’s bandmate Harry Styles reportedly inked a solo deal last month, though he never announced the signing publicly. It’s still not clear whose solo album will be first out the gate, but Liam might just have taken the lead.
